Square Enix has surprisingly released Bravely Default Flying Fairy HD Remaster on Xbox Series and Xbox PC, expanding the available platforms for one of the most beloved JRPGs of recent years. The game is now available in digital format and also features Xbox Play Anywhere compatibility, allowing players to enjoy it on both console and PC with a single purchase.
This new version includes improved graphics, quality-of-life adjustments, and new minigames, as well as being optimized to run on portable devices like the ROG Xbox Ally.
A Classic JRPG Returns to Xbox
The original title was released in 2012 for Nintendo 3DS and marked the beginning of the Bravely series, a franchise that has sold over four million copies worldwide over the years.
The story follows Tiz, Agnès, Edea, and Ringabel, four characters who embark on a journey to close a massive rift threatening the world and restore balance to the elemental crystals. As the adventure unfolds, they will discover that the mission is more complex than it initially seemed.
One of the most memorable elements of the game is its Brave & Default combat system, which introduces a strategic mechanic to the turns, allowing players to accumulate or spend actions to perform multiple attacks in a single turn.
This remaster also reclaims the game’s original Japanese title, Bravely Default Flying Fairy, and adapts it for current consoles with a revamped visual aspect.
